計算機概論題目幫幫忙解答:)

1. 下列何者不是電腦架構(Architecture)之基本組成部份?

A 輸出入裝置(I/O Device); B 中央處理單元(CPU);

C 記憶體(Memory); D 微程式控制器(Micro Controller)。

2. 下列何者不含在 CPU 晶片內?

A Control Unit; B Register; C Main Memory; D ALU。

3. 下列敘述何者不正確?

A 磁碟中一次所能夠存取的最小儲存區域是Track(磁軌);

B BIOS(基本輸入輸出系統)通常儲存於ROM;

C RAM 於電源關閉後其內容會消失而無法復原;

D Cache Memory 可用來改善主記憶體的存取速度。

4. 假設一部時脈速度為1000 MHz ( megahertz ) 的電腦且CPI ( Clock cycle per

instruction ) 為5,則此部電腦的MIPS ( Million instructions per second ) 為多

少? A 100; B 200; C 2000; D 5000。

5. 下列何者不是用來連接硬體裝置的連接埠?

A PS/2; B 序列埠; C TCP/IP; D 並列埠。

6. 將十進位數字系統中 14.37510 之數值轉成二進位數字系統時,其值應為:(此題只考慮

數值大小,不考慮正負號)

A 1110.0112; B 1110.1012; C 1010.0112; D 1010.1012 。

7. 一個二進位數目往左位移二位元後,則其值變為原來的

A 二倍; B 四倍; C 二分之一; D 四分之一。

8. 經加上偶同位檢查位元後,下列代碼何者正確?

A 00101111; B 10101110; C 11000010; D 10110010。

9. 若「1」代表真;「0」代表假,布林代數(Boolean Algebra)運算中,下列何者為真?

A 1 AND 0=1; B 0 OR 1=1; C 1 AND 1=0; D 1 OR 1=0。

10. 二進位數字 0010002 ,其六位元2 的補數為:

A 1010002; B 1101112; C 1110002; D 0010012。

11. 下列何者不是文字的編碼方式? A ASCII; B Unicode; C AVI; D Big5。

12. 請依照下列裝置的存取速度,由快到慢依序排列

甲:快取記憶體、 乙:硬碟、 丙:暫存器、 丁:主記憶體

A 丙丁乙甲; B 甲丙丁乙; C 甲丁丙乙; D 丙甲丁乙。

13. 下列何者是 CPU 可直接執行的程式語言?

A 機器語言; B 組合語言; C Pascal 程式; D Basic 程式。

14. 下列敘述何者不正確?

A DPI 表示每英吋所呈現的列印點數;

B PPI 表示每英吋所擷取的像素數目;

C BPI 表示每英吋磁帶可以儲存幾個Bits;

D 1 奈秒(Nanosecond)表示10-9 秒。

15. 對 CPU 進行組織上的改進可以增強其功能,一個常用的方法為同時處理多個指令的抓取

fetch)、解碼(decode)、及執行(execute)各步驟,如工廠生產線一般,這種方法叫做

A Cascading; B Pipelining; C Overlapping; D Buffering。

16. 結構化程式設計的三種基本邏輯為循序、選擇及

A 重複; B 隨機; C 直接; D 相關。

17. 下列有關程式被轉換成執行檔的敘述,何者不正確?

A 編譯器的輸入是原始程式檔;

B 原始程式檔是由Loader 負責載入編譯器中;

C Linker 的功能是將不同的目的程式檔連結成可執行檔;

D 直譯器能夠執行原始程式。

18. 如下列之 BASIC 程式語言,其執行結果為何? A 10; B 20; C 26; D 41。

Dim i, j, s As Integer

s = 2

For i = 1 To 2

For j = 5 To 3 Step -2

s = s + i * j

Next j

Next i

Print s

19. 如下列之 C 程式語言,其執行結果為何? A 2; B 3; C 4; D 5。

#include <stdio.h>

int test(int m, int n)

{

if(m==0) return n+2;

else if(n==0) return test(m-1, 1);

else return test(m-1, test(m, n-1));

}

void main( )

{

printf("%d", test(1,1));

}

20. C++ 是下列哪一種程式語言?

A 程序式; B 函式; C 物件導向式; D 宣告式。

1 Answer

Rating
  • 1 decade ago
    Favorite Answer

    1.D

    2.C

    3.A

    4.B

    5.C

    6.A

    7.B

    8.D

    9.B

    10.C

    11.C

    12.D

    13.A

    14.C

    15.B

    16.A

    17.B

    18.C

    19.D

    20.C

Still have questions? Get your answers by asking now.